Equity Theory
A theory of motivation that explains how employees perceive fairness in workplace reward distribution, comparing their input-outcome ratios to those of others.
Perceived Inequity
Perceived inequity occurs when an individual believes that the ratio of their inputs to outcomes is not equal to the input-outcome ratios of others, leading to feelings of dissatisfaction and unfair treatment.

McClelland's Motivation Theory
A psychological theory that identifies three primary drivers of motivation: need for achievement, need for affiliation, and need for power.
